What Happens at 1.35 ATA

At 1.35 ATA, atmospheric pressure gently increases. This allows oxygen to dissolve more efficiently into plasma, not just bind to red blood cells.

The result:

  • Greater oxygen diffusion into tissues
  • Improved mitochondrial efficiency
  • Enhanced ATP production
  • Accelerated tissue repair

In simple terms, your cells receive more usable oxygen, and they use it more effectively.
